Many software‐dominant organizations ignore systems engineering completely. A recent popular book described one such organization in a fable format. The INCOSE Systems and Software Interface Working Group chose to read this book as a weekly professional development seminar to investigate where systems engineering should fit in software‐dominant organizations of the type that do not currently involve INCOSE's systems engineers. This seminar culminated in an “author day,” where the book's author responded to our questions and discussed our potential role. The book club activities produced several drafts we can turn into products to help INCOSE systems engineers better understand software, and systems engineers' potential role in such organizations, to help improve software‐intensive system success.
